Struktur
Dasar Komputer
Sebuah
komputer moderen/digital dengan program yang tersimpan di dalamnya merupakan
sebuah system yang memanipulasi dan memproses informasi menurut kumpulan
instruksi yang diberikan. Sistem tersebut dirancang dari modul-modul hardware
seperti :
1. Register
2. Elemen aritmatika dan logika
3. Unit pengendali
4. Unit memori
5. Unit masukan/keluaran (I/O)
Komputer dapat dibagi menjadi 3 bagian utama, yaitu :
2. Elemen aritmatika dan logika
3. Unit pengendali
4. Unit memori
5. Unit masukan/keluaran (I/O)
Komputer dapat dibagi menjadi 3 bagian utama, yaitu :
1. Unit pengolahan pusat (CPU)
2. Unit masukan/keluaran (I/O)
3. Unit memori
Suatu
sistem komputer terdiri dari lima unit struktur dasar, yaitu:
·
Unit masukan (Input Unit)
·
Unit kontrol (Control Unit)
·
Unit logika dan aritmatika (Arithmetic
& Logical Unit / ALU)
·
Unit memori/penyimpanan (Memory
/ Storage Unit)
·
Unit keluaran (Output Unit)
Control Unit
dan ALU membentuk suatu unit tersendiri yang disebut Central Processing
Unit (CPU).
Hubungan
antar masing-masing unit yang membentuk suatu sistem komputer dapat dilihat
pada gambar berikut:
Data
diterima melalui Input Device dan dikirim ke Memory. Di dalam Memory data
disimpan dan selanjutnya diproses di ALU. Hasil proses disimpan kembali ke
Memory sebelum dikeluarkan melalui Output Device. Kendali dan koordinasi
terhadap sistem ini dilakukan oleh Control Unit. Secara ringkas prinsip kerja
komputer adalah Input – Proses – Output, yang dikenal dengan
singkatan IPO.
Fungsi
Utama dari masing-masing Unit akan dijelaskan berikut ini:
Unit
Masukan (Input Unit)
Berfungsi untuk menerima masukan (input) kemudian membacanya dan diteruskan ke Memory / penyimpanan. Dalam hubungan ini dikenal istilah peralatan masukan (input device) yaitu alat penerima dan pembaca masukan serta media masukan yaitu perantaranya.
Berfungsi untuk menerima masukan (input) kemudian membacanya dan diteruskan ke Memory / penyimpanan. Dalam hubungan ini dikenal istilah peralatan masukan (input device) yaitu alat penerima dan pembaca masukan serta media masukan yaitu perantaranya.
Unit
Kontrol (Control Unit)
Berfungsi untuk melaksanakan tugas pengawasan dan pengendalian seluruh sistem komputer. Ia berfungsi seperti pengatur rumah tangga komputer, memutuskan urutan operasi untuk seluruh sistem, membangkitkan dan mengendalikan sinyal-sinyal kontrol untuk menyesuaikan operasi-operasi dan arus data dari bus alamat (address bus) dan bus data (data bus), serta mengendalikan dan menafsirkan sinyal-sinyal kontrol pada bus kontrol (control bus) dari sistem komputer. Pengertian mengenai bus dapat dilihat di bagian bawah halaman ini.
Berfungsi untuk melaksanakan tugas pengawasan dan pengendalian seluruh sistem komputer. Ia berfungsi seperti pengatur rumah tangga komputer, memutuskan urutan operasi untuk seluruh sistem, membangkitkan dan mengendalikan sinyal-sinyal kontrol untuk menyesuaikan operasi-operasi dan arus data dari bus alamat (address bus) dan bus data (data bus), serta mengendalikan dan menafsirkan sinyal-sinyal kontrol pada bus kontrol (control bus) dari sistem komputer. Pengertian mengenai bus dapat dilihat di bagian bawah halaman ini.
Unit
Logika & Aritmatika (Arithmetical
& Logical Unit)
Berfungsi untuk melaksanakan pekerjaan perhitungan atau aritmatika & logika seperti menambah, mengurangi, mengalikan, membagi dan memangkatkan. Selain itu juga melaksanakan pekerjaan seperti pemindahan data, penyatuan data, pemilihan data, membandingkan data, dll, sehingga ALU merupakan bagian inti dari suatu sistem komputer. Pada beberapa sistem komputer untuk memperingan dan membantu tugas ALU dari CPU ini diberi suatu peralatan tambahan yang disebut coprocessor sehingga khususnya proses perhitungan serta pelaksanaan pekerjaan pada umumnya menjadi lebih cepat. Pengertian mengenai coprocessor dapat dilihat di bagian bawah halaman ini.
Berfungsi untuk melaksanakan pekerjaan perhitungan atau aritmatika & logika seperti menambah, mengurangi, mengalikan, membagi dan memangkatkan. Selain itu juga melaksanakan pekerjaan seperti pemindahan data, penyatuan data, pemilihan data, membandingkan data, dll, sehingga ALU merupakan bagian inti dari suatu sistem komputer. Pada beberapa sistem komputer untuk memperingan dan membantu tugas ALU dari CPU ini diberi suatu peralatan tambahan yang disebut coprocessor sehingga khususnya proses perhitungan serta pelaksanaan pekerjaan pada umumnya menjadi lebih cepat. Pengertian mengenai coprocessor dapat dilihat di bagian bawah halaman ini.
Unit
Memori / Penyimpan (Memory / Storage
unit)
Berfungsi untuk menampung data/program yang diterima dari unit masukan sebelum diolah oleh CPU dan juga menerima data setelah diolah oleh CPU yang selanjutnya diteruskan ke unit keluaran. Pada suatu sistem komputer terdapat dua macam memori, yang penamaannya tergantung pada apakah alat tersebut hanya dapat membaca atau dapat membaca dan menulis padanya. Bagian memori yang hanya dapat membaca tanpa bisa menulis padanya disebut ROM (Read Only Memory), sedangkan bagian memori yang dapat melaksanakan membaca dan menulis disebut RAM (Random Access Memory).
Berfungsi untuk menampung data/program yang diterima dari unit masukan sebelum diolah oleh CPU dan juga menerima data setelah diolah oleh CPU yang selanjutnya diteruskan ke unit keluaran. Pada suatu sistem komputer terdapat dua macam memori, yang penamaannya tergantung pada apakah alat tersebut hanya dapat membaca atau dapat membaca dan menulis padanya. Bagian memori yang hanya dapat membaca tanpa bisa menulis padanya disebut ROM (Read Only Memory), sedangkan bagian memori yang dapat melaksanakan membaca dan menulis disebut RAM (Random Access Memory).
Unit
Keluaran (Output Unit)
Berfungsi untuk menerima hasil pengolahan data dari CPU melalui memori. Seperti halnya pada unit masukan maka pada unit keluaran dikenal juga istilah peralatan keluaran (Output device) dan media keluaran (Output media).
Berfungsi untuk menerima hasil pengolahan data dari CPU melalui memori. Seperti halnya pada unit masukan maka pada unit keluaran dikenal juga istilah peralatan keluaran (Output device) dan media keluaran (Output media).
Organisasi
Komputer
Organisasi
Komputer adalah bagian yang terkait erat dengan unit-unit operasional dan
interkoneksi antar komponen penyusun sistem komputer dalam merealisasikan aspek
arsitekturnya. Contoh aspek organisasional adalah teknologi hardware, perangkat
antarmuka, teknologi memori, sistem memori, dan sinyal-sinyal kontrol.
Organisasi Komputer mempelajari bagian yang terkait dengan unit‑unit operasional komputer dan hubungan antara komponen sistem komputer.
contoh: sinyal kontrol, interface / antar muka, teknologi memori peripheral ( Perangkat keras / Hasdware adalah semua bagian fisik komputer dan dibedakan dengan data yang berada di dalamnya atau yang beroperasi di dalamnya, dan dibedakan dengan perangkat lunak (software) yang menyediakan instruksi untuk perangkat keras dalam menyelesaikan tugasnya.
Organisasi Komputer mempelajari bagian yang terkait dengan unit‑unit operasional komputer dan hubungan antara komponen sistem komputer.
contoh: sinyal kontrol, interface / antar muka, teknologi memori peripheral ( Perangkat keras / Hasdware adalah semua bagian fisik komputer dan dibedakan dengan data yang berada di dalamnya atau yang beroperasi di dalamnya, dan dibedakan dengan perangkat lunak (software) yang menyediakan instruksi untuk perangkat keras dalam menyelesaikan tugasnya.
Objek
Organisasi Komputer
1.Unit-unit operasional komputer
adalah Hubungan antara komponen sistem komputer
Contoh: teknologi hardware, perangkat
antarmuka,teknologi memori, sistem memori, dan sinyal–sinyal
2.Struktur & Fungsi Komputer
Struktur adalah sistem yang berinteraksi dengancara
tertentu dengan dunia luar.
Fungsi adalah operasi dari masing-masing komponen
yang merupakan bagian dari struktur
Fungsi dari Komputer :
·
Fungsi Operasi Pengolahan Data
·
Fungsi Operasi Penyimpanan Data
·
Fungsi Operasi Pemindahan Data
·
Fungsi Operasi Kontrol
3.Komputer Sebagai Mesin Multilevel
Tingkatan
bahasa dan mesin virtual yang mencerminkan kemudahan komunikasi antara manusia
sebagai pemrogram dengan komponen elektronik dalam sebuah komputer sebagai
pelaksana
Prinsip Mesin Multilevel :
Semakin tinggi level mesin, semakin mudah cara
komunikasinya
logika
multi level
Bahasa mesin yang memerlukan interpreter untuk
diterjemahkan ke dalam mesin L(n-1)
Bahasa mesin yang memerlukan interpreter untuk
diterjemahkan ke dalam mesin L1
Bahasa mesin yang memerlukan interpreter untuk
diterjemahkan ke dalam mesin L0
Lingkup rekayasa elektronik, program langsung
dijalankan oleh sirkuit elektronik.
Komputer sebagai Mesin 6 level
Level Bahasa Tingkat Tinggi
Level Bahasa Rakitan; bahasa aras rendah (assembler)
Level Mesin Sistem Operasi; interpretasi parsial
oleh Sistem Operasi
Level Arsitektur Perangkat Instruksi; instruksi
dasar mesin sesuai manual pabrik
Level Arsitektur Mikro; rangkaian dasar prosesor
Level logika digital; logika dibuat dalam logika
gerbang
Fase
Umum Perkembangan Komputer
Tahap
Manual
Ditemukan
sistem penghitungan oleh manusia melalui hitungan jari, tanah liat. 9000 – 2500
SM : dikenal sistem perhitungan jam, kalender, rumus, dan fungsi hitungan.
Berkembang seiring ditemukan beberapa sistem baru seperti perbankan, audit. Sampai
sekarang masih dipakai.
Tahap
Mekanikal
Pascaline (kalkulator Tradisional) oleh Blaise
Pascal (1623 – 1662)
Logic Demonstrator ( mesin logika) oleh Charles Mahon (1777)
Logic Demonstrator ( mesin logika) oleh Charles Mahon (1777)
Babbage’s Analitycal Engine ( alat hitung/
kalkulator, oleh Charles Babbage (1833)
Tahap
Mekanik Elektronik
Diawali dengan penemuan mesin tabulasi kartu plong
pada tahun 1890 oleh Dr. Herman Holerith. Dari amerika membuat mesin ini untuk
digunakan sensus penduduk dan kemudian bekerja sama mendirikan perusahaan IBM (
International Bussines Machine )
Tahap
Elektronik
Ditandai dengan penemuan komputer pertama ABC
(Anatasoff-Berry Computer) yang menggunakan tabung hampa udara (1942)
Dilanjut dengan MARK I oleh Howard Aiken (1944)
Dilanjut dengan MARK I oleh Howard Aiken (1944)
sumber :
http://antmountain.blogspot.com/2012/01/struktur-dasar-dan-organisasi-komputer.html
http://kaholeo.blogspot.com/2014/04/contoh-makalah-struktur-organisasi.html
Tidak ada komentar:
Posting Komentar